Summary
This summary covers 18 available inspections for Playing and Learning Day Care and Learning Center from September 13, 2021 through April 13, 2026.
Six inspections recorded violations, with nine recorded violations in total.
The most recent recorded violation was on February 2, 2026 and involved recordkeeping.
Staff training was a higher-concern topic that showed up in one inspection.
A later inspection showed no recorded violations, but the records do not say whether it was a formal follow-up.

During a DFPS investigation it was found that a child was left unsupervised in the outdoor play area/patio for at least 10 minutes leaving the child at risk. This investigation disposition was Reason To Believe for Neglectful Supervision.
Correction deadline
April 21, 2023
Correction status
Correction evaluated April 26, 2023
More details
Official Texas risk level
High
Report section
746.1201(4) - AP Responsibilities of Employees and Caregivers -Ensure No Child Abused, Neglected, or Exploited
Official code
746.1201(4)
Higher concern: Supervision
Report finding
During a DFPS investigation it was found that a child was left unsupervised in the outdoor play area/patio for at least 10 minutes. The caregiver responsible for this child was not within physical proximity of the child and did not have auditory or visual awareness of the child. During this same investigation, it was also determined that another child was unattended in the lobby area.

Higher concern: Transportation
Report finding
During inspection, while observing unloading procedures, a caregiver was observed unloading a total of seven children when the vehicle only had five available seats with individual safety belts. Therefore, the two extra children were sharing safety belts. This was corrected at inspection after the caregiver unloaded the children.
